Php developers can benefit from the efficient, wellorganized, reusable, and easytounderstand code that object oriented programming offers. Students of objectoriented programming can often be heard having lengthy, subtle discussions about correct and incorrect uses of inheritance. Object oriented oo design encourages cleaner interfaces between sections of code and results in code that is easier to debug, and scales better for large programming teams. Objectoriented python programming for computer games, or who knows what else. Dan ingalls lectures on objectoriented programming. Object oriented programming the term was coined by alan kay is a programming approach whereby one creates a network of cooperating operational models, called objects, that work together as. Lesson 1 introduction to objectoriented programming in. In this subject were going to emphasize using classes in the context of whats called objectoriented programming. This course covers the fundamental concepts of oo design and programming and then demonstrates how. Objectoriented programming, or oop for short, is a programming paradigm which provides a means of structuring programs so that properties and behaviors are bundled into individual objects. Objectoriented programming is the development of code in a language that enforces objectoriented design principles. Pythons simple syntax, consistent semantics, and wide popularity make it an exceptionally attractive instructional language for new programmers. Object oriented programming in javascript udemy free download learn all about oop, understand the most confusing parts of javascript and prepare for technical interviews.
List of objectoriented programming languages wikipedia. From classes to inheritance oop indepth for python programmers. This tutorialcourse is created by bruce van horn and it has been retrieved from lynda which you can download for absolutely free. Python 3 objectoriented programming third edition github. Objectoriented design with java online course video lectures by. In this python beyond the basics objectoriented programming training course, expert author david blaikie will teach you how to design python classes, and how to implement objectoriented programming concepts in python. This text embraces pythons objectoriented nature, presenting a balanced and flexible approach to mastering objectoriented principles. The problem is that theres lots of bad info out there about oop. In this intermediatelevel course, kevin skoglund introduces objectoriented programming oop principles for php. This program is also very useful for those that want to learn how to create a complete login system in php. It comes up often in technical interviews, and its an essential skill for every developer. Note that, in some contexts, the definition of an objectoriented programming language is not exactly the same as that of a programming language with objectoriented features.
This is the code repository for python 3 objectoriented programming third edition, published by packt build robust and maintainable software with objectoriented design patterns in python 3. Aug 07, 2016 when we take a closer look at the first 2 chapters a few things begin to emerge and the concept of object oriented programming manifests as the approach to creation. The book teaches developing web applications using advanced php techniques and advanced database concepts, and this edition offers several chapters devoted to objectoriented programming and allnew chapters on debugging, testing, and performance and using the zend framework. The system has many features that enable you to learn php object oriented programming oop. Objectoriented programming in javascript udemy download free. In this intermediatelevel course, kevin skoglund introduces object oriented programming oop principles for php. This is the only complete php login system developed in core php. Topics object, oriented, programming, usingc, kendal collection opensource language english. There was limited scope of objectoriented programming in php 4, but in php 5, the object model was rewritten for better performance and more features. Simply put, objectoriented programming oop is a popular style of programming. In this intermediate course, kevin skoglund teaches powerful php techniques that streamline interactions with mysql databases. Search for and download any torrent from the pirate bay using search query object oriented programming.
Objectoriented programming oop is a popular programming paradigm or style of programming. It is important to bear in mind that inheritance, in the end, is just a trick that allows lazy3 programmers to write less code. This is a list of notable programming languages with object oriented programming oop features, which are also listed in category. The reason is that classes and objects are everywhere in production code and so hiring managers will be looking to. Objectoriented programming is an approach to programming where objects and classes are used. As detailed in my book, pro php and jquery, youll learn the concepts behind objectoriented programming oop, a style of coding in which related actions are grouped into classes to aid in creating morecompact, effective code. Kevin shows how to define a class, add properties and methods, and create new instances. The pirate bay the galaxys most resilient bittorrent site. Logic programming java programming object oriented programming oop sorting algorithm. Oct 10, 2011 the complete up and running with vba in access course has a total duration of 4 hours and 38 minutes, and introduces object oriented programming, explores the access object model, and covers the. The objectoriented thought process developers library.
Alim ul karim on behalf of techforum as microsoft technical communitymstc event. See answer to why is oop object oriented programming the standard paradigm for most software. This is a list of notable programming languages with objectoriented programming oop features, which are also listed in category. Thus, the question of whether inheritance is being used correctly boils. And if you go look up at python books on the web, or java books on the web, about 80% of them will include the word objectoriented in their title. Excellent tips for a better ebook reading experience. Php developers will benefit from the efficient, wellorganized, reusable, and easytounderstand code that object oriented programming oop offers. The objectoriented approach is very important when we write our applications due to the possibility to reuse our applications or to reuse parts of it. Object oriented programming is a style of coding that allows developers to group similar tasks into classes. This text embraces pythons object oriented nature, presenting a balanced and flexible approach to mastering object oriented principles, and building a solid framework for advanc. With the help of this course you can get started with java and objectoriented programming.
Furthermore, oop concepts help us writing cleaner and maintainable code, which is a huge advantage in bigger projects. Oct 29, 2018 python 3 objectoriented programming third edition. In summary, we have a very powerful program for working with python. Logic programming java programming objectoriented programming oop sorting algorithm. The object of murder 1 hours and 00 minutes movie 2019 homicide detectives reveal how unique objects, often with an emotional connection to the victim, have provided vital clues in solving murder cases. Object oriented programming is the development of code in a language that enforces object oriented design principles. It is a userdefined data type, which holds its own data members and member functions, which can be accessed and used by creating an instance of that class. The oop or object oriented programming is a paradigm that allows you to write a program by modeling realworld things in terms of class and object. Which is the best book to learn the concepts of object.
Object oriented programming oop is a popular programming paradigm or style of programming. Its also packed with updated content to reflect recent changes in the core python library and covers modern thirdparty packages that were not available on the python 3 platform when the book was first published. Jetbrains pycharm professional 2019 fastdl torrent discipline of. You might think that at first but it is not so at all. Visual studio community the free edition of visual studio description. Python 3 objectoriented programming second edition. Objectoriented oo design encourages cleaner interfaces between sections of code and results in code that is easier to debug, and scales better for large programming teams. For many php programmers, objectoriented programming is a frightening concept, full of complicated syntax and other roadblocks. Udemy java objectoriented programming build a quiz. This course will introduce you to some of the most powerful programming concepts in java, including. Objectoriented programming oop is a popular style of programming. Object oriented programming, or oop for short, is a programming paradigm which provides a means of structuring programs so that properties and behaviors are bundled into individual objects.
Object oriented programming oop is a way of thinking, it is a methodology that is implemented in. Note that, in some contexts, the definition of an object oriented programming language is not exactly the same as that of a programming language with object oriented features. For instance, an object could represent a person with a name property, age, address, etc. Objectoriented programming oop in python 3 real python.
Welcome to our course on object oriented programming in java using data. Students of object oriented programming can often be heard having lengthy, subtle discussions about correct and incorrect uses of inheritance. Objectoriented programming the term was coined by alan kay is a programming approach whereby one creates a network of cooperating. In this course, youll learn to program in an objectoriented way and will also develop an objectoriented way of thinking. The complete up and running with vba in access course has a total duration of 4 hours and 38 minutes, and introduces objectoriented programming. One of the major benefits of dry programming is that, if a piece of information changes in your program, usually only one change is required to update the code. Objectoriented programming in javascript download free. It comes up in technical interviews often and its an essential skill for every developer. Its a bit different than anything weve done until now. Object oriented programming in javagrow your portfolio as a software engineer offered by duke university, and university of california san diego. Net basic constructs course last time with the article about mathematical functions in vb.
And if you go look up at python books on the web, or java books on the web, about 80% of them will include the word object oriented in their title. Lynda objectoriented programming with php download. Python beyond the basics objectoriented programming udemy. Oop helps you manage and reduce complexity in software by building reusable building blocks objects. Learn how to interact with databases using objectoriented php code. Php developers will benefit from the efficient, wellorganized, reusable, and easytounderstand code that objectoriented programming oop offers. In this subject were going to emphasize using classes in the context of whats called object oriented programming. Object oriented python programming for computer games, or who knows what else. This tutorialcourse is created by jesse freeman and it has been retrieved from lynda which you can download for absolutely free.
See answer to why is oop objectoriented programming the standard paradigm for most software. One of the biggest nightmares for developers is maintaining code where. Learn object oriented programming in java from university of california san diego. Developer and programming languages skills are covered in this course. Objectoriented programming in javascript code with mosh. Objectoriented design and programming in labview national. We have 436 javaprogramming ebooks torrents for you. When we take a closer look at the first 2 chapters a few things begin to emerge and the concept of object oriented programming manifests as the approach to creation. Topics object, oriented, programming, usingc, kendal.
Objects also form the basis for many web technologies such as javascript, python, and php. Learn object oriented programming oop in php learn object oriented programming oop in php objectoriented programming oop is a type of programming added to php5 that makes building complex, modular and reusable web applications that much easier. Objectoriented design with java free online course video tutorial by other. The book teaches developing web applications using advanced php techniques and advanced database concepts, and this edition offers several chapters devoted to object oriented programming and allnew chapters on debugging, testing, and performance and using the zend framework. Instructor objectoriented programming is a very large component of almost all technical interviews where you would be using python. Objectoriented programming in javascript udemy download. Simply put, object oriented programming oop is a popular style of programming. Learn how to interact with databases using object oriented php code. Ultimate java part 2 objectoriented programming code. Python beyond the basics object oriented programming o. This new edition includes all the topics that made python 3 objectoriented programming an instant packt classic. Thats because its not a programming language or a tool.
252 425 986 1044 726 532 674 585 1232 236 1247 359 1163 1133 898 50 635 620 626 684 1230 1472 1316 501 132 457 614 1458 1155 360 933 1136 815 807 486 264 1175 1351 937 56